v2.26.7: fix health check SDR detection on macOS (#188)
timeout (GNU coreutils) is not available on macOS, causing rtl_test to silently fail and report no SDR device found. Now tries timeout, then gtimeout (Homebrew coreutils), then falls back to background process with manual kill.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>
